A purity ball is a formal dance event typically practised by some conservative Christian groups in the United States.The events are attended by fathers and their teenage daughters in order to promote virginity until marriage.Typically, daughters who attend a purity ball make a virginity pledge to remain sexually abstinent until marriage.
